With just one month to go till 2022 and the January window, Rangers fans are feverishly calling upon the club to reverse one of the ex’s worst errors by recalling Niko Katic from Split rather than selling him as per the loan clause agreement.

The 25 year old is currently a regular for his home country side, and while he conceded a penalty v Belupo (his ex side, of course) he’s done very well in Split with an overall 84% level of passing and a stunning 73% of all aerial duels won.

In short, he’s continuing to impress and many fans are eager to see him return to where he wants to be.

Katic took this club to his heart, and of course the fans are a huge reason why, but the ex-boss just didn’t like him and wasn’t interested.

But now with our defensive resources stretched thin, it seems like January would be more prudent to bring Katic back rather than be without.

Gio will be making his own stamp at that point, and whether Katic fits his archetype we’ll see, but if it was up to fans the Croat would be back at Ibrox yesterday.
